Afficher les posts WordPress sur google maps dans une application mobile avec REST Api, Ionic

WordPress Indiquer coordonnées Lat et Long dans deux champs personnalisés “lat” et “lng” Ex : lat = 43.785687 et long = 48,456778 Inclure les champs personnalisés dans REST. Dans fonctions.php : function slug_get_post_meta_cb( $object, $field_name, $request ) { return get_post_meta( $object[ ‘id’ ], $field_name ); } add_action( ‘rest_api_init’, function() { register_api_field( ‘post’, ‘lat’, array( ‘get_callback’ En savoir plus surAfficher les posts WordPress sur google maps dans une application mobile avec REST Api, Ionic[…]

Remplir automatiquement un formulaire de commentaire

Console JS $(‘input#author’).each(function() { var paramValue = “Mon Nom”; if(this.value == “” && paramValue != “”) this.value = paramValue; }); $(‘input#email’).each(function() { var paramValue = “mon@email”; if(this.value == “” && paramValue != “”) this.value = paramValue; }); $(‘textarea#comment’).each(function() { var paramValue = “Mon commentaire…”; if(this.value == “” && paramValue != “”) this.value = paramValue; });

Pagination HTML JS

JS <script> var current_page = 1; var records_per_page = 3; var objJson = [ {“id”: 1 , “firstName”: ” AA “,”title”:” XX”}, {“id”: 2 , “firstName”: ” AA “,”title”:” XX”}, {“id”: 3 , “firstName”: ” AA “,”title”:” XX”}, {“id”: 4 , “firstName”: ” AA “,”title”:” XX”}, {“id”: 5 , “firstName”: ” AA “,”title”:” XX”}, {“id”: En savoir plus surPagination HTML JS[…]

Afficher/Cacher bloc

Pour afficher ou cacher un bloc en cliquant sur un bouton Js function mydivFunction() { function mydivFunction() {    var x = document.getElementById(‘myinfoDIV’);    if (x.style.display === ‘none’) {        x.style.display = ‘block’;    } else {        x.style.display = ‘none’;    }} HTML <div id=”myinfoDIV”>Hello</div> <button onclick=”mydivFunction()”>Click Me</button>

Forcer l’orientation de l’affichage en CSS ou Js

Detecter l’orientation de l’appareil en CSS3 : @media screen and (orientation:portrait) { // Portrait mode } @media screen and (orientation:landscape) { // Landscape mode } Ou inclure une orientation JavaScript : document.addEventListener(“orientationchange”, function(event){ switch(window.orientation) { case -90: case 90: /* Device is in landscape mode */ break; default: /* Device is in portrait mode */ } En savoir plus surForcer l’orientation de l’affichage en CSS ou Js[…]

URL variable parametre GET

Récupérer une variable dans l’URL : echo $_GET[‘link’]; If Else <?php if (isset($_GET[‘link’])) { echo $_GET[‘link’]; }else{ // Fallback behaviour goes here } ?> Server $parameter = $_SERVER[‘QUERY_STRING’]; echo $parameter; or Just use echo $_GET[‘link’];

Zone d’image clicable

Créer des zones de lien hypertexte sur une image : Définir l’id du code correspondant à l’image (#image-map) Indiquer les coordonnées (“91,122,11” représente un cercle avec les coordonnées x,y = 91,122 et un radius de 11)   <img src=”melk01010101010101.png” usemap=”#image-map”> <map name=”image-map”> <area target=”_self” alt=”melk” title=”melk” href=”https://melk.fr/” coords=”91,122,11″ shape=”circle”> <area target=”_self” alt=”melk2″ title=”melk2″ href=”https://melk.fr/” coords=”201,288,6″ En savoir plus surZone d’image clicable[…]

error: Content is protected !!